Shaos, не нужно, вот кассеты и документация по цветному Апогею. Цветной тетрис там тоже есть....
Тип: Сообщения; Пользователь: Pyk; Ключевые слова:
Shaos, не нужно, вот кассеты и документация по цветному Апогею. Цветной тетрис там тоже есть....
Нашел у себя. Кажется, это вообще с комплектной кассеты цветного Апогея.
Надо бы заняться сортировкой архивов, наверняка и еще что-то интересное найдется...
Проверил - действительно. Самому интересно, почему так. Будет время - посмотрю, навскидку нет предположений...
- - - Добавлено - - -
P. S. Предположения появились, поэкспериментирую ;)
Там в стакане 10 столбцов, для простоты можно жестко зафиксировать 10 позиций атрибутов...
Не так уж и мозголомно получается...
Тоже задавался этим вопросом, хорошо, что напомнил.
Вообще, этот вариант тетриса есть на картриджах, которые продаются здесь:
Где автор взял исходник, я не знаю. Там, кажется, была и еще какая-то...
Я далек от этой темы, но думаю, это потому, что отсутствует для Win32 используемый для создания Native-приложения GraalVM.
А jar-версия под Win32 тоже не работает?...
Будет в какой-то степени в новом отладчике. Встречный вопрос - поделишься опытом - какие именно окна нужно отделять и для чего? В основном наверное для того, чтобы расширить размер отдельных областей...
Хочу упомянуть еще новый Си-подобный язык Millfork:
https://karols.github.io/millfork/
Позиционируется как язык среднего уровня. Немного экспериментировал с ним, впечатления очень неплохие.
Даже...
Посмотрел. Да, неплохая идея. Конечно, надо будет сделать эту карту как минимум кликабельной, да и вообще, подумать, как эту идею развить...
ivagor, спасибо, посмотрю как у него сделано. Кстати, пришло в голову, что и идею "базыря" из v06x можно использовать, просто немного в другом качестве, да и Alikberov, тоже выше на подобное...
CityAceE, ну вот и надо подумать, в каком виде это можно было бы реализовать. В классическом виде процедур здесь нет, вывести проценты по именам функций не получится... Может быть, в каком-то...
Alikberov, пожелания понятны. Отладчик как раз перерабатываю, хотя и медленно дело идет. Что из этого получится учесть, пока не знаю.
CityAceE, разово замерить количество тактов, за которое выполняется функция, не проблема и сейчас. Я так понимаю, что нужна именно статистика в том или ином виде, процент процессорного времени,...
Надо бы найти проблему, раз он падает, тем более стабильно - проще будет локализовать.
Если что, у меня есть утилита bin2tape для конвертирования бинарных файлов в rk и еще кучу форматов.
...
Ничего не обещаю, но есть одна идея, подумаю.
Мне эта фича кажется чужеродной в эмуляторе. Ассемблерами все пользуются разными, часто проекты состоят далеко не из одного файла, а сборку и запуск...
Alikberov, я сначала подумал про lst-файлы для отладчика.
Предлагаешь встроить ассемблер в эмулятор?
Прогресс, действительно, некоторый есть. Думаю, в марте.
Сложно и сомнительна необходимость, вряд ли сделаю, по крайней мере в ближайшее время :(
Есть в планах, хотя и не не ближайшую...
Почему-то именно в Бейсике вывод BEEP был сделан на магнитофонный выход, а не на встроенный динамик через EI/DI.
Да, он.
Пытался пищать через BEEP, но не очень удачно ;) Там и так сделать...
Совсем забыл про него, тем более, что он не работал в Микроне ни на Апогее, ни на Партнере.
Посмотрю, что можно сделать.
- - - Добавлено - - -
Оригинальный бейсик для РК пищит в магнитофонный...
Beaver, да. Конечно, в режиме 32К предполагается бОльшая совместимость и в случае несовместимости минимальное количество изменений, но тем не менее.
Надо будет еще в репозитории сделать отдельную...
Beaver, разобрался с режимом 48К, отредактировал сообщение выше.
Разобрался. Для Пальмиры в режиме 32К нужны следующие правки:
1925: 76 -> D7
1933: 76 -> D7
Бейсик обращается к служебным ячейкам Монитора для установки положения курсора.
Для запуска в режиме...
Beaver, я уже плохо помню нюансы бейсика, поэтому, чтобы разобраться:
дай ссылку на файл конкретного бейсика
напомни синтаксис позиционирования курсора в бейсике
Также можно...
Alikberov, что имеется в виду под режимом памяти?
Ратмир, я так понимаю. что в разрыве - атрибут 81H?
Если в 2 словах, то вообще можно, но для этого нужно перепрограммировать ВГ75 для работы с прозрачными атрибутами и учесть уйму разных нюансов для...